A definition for starters: Learning is a process that is often not under our control and is wrapped up with the environments we inhabit and the relationships we make. Learning, like reflexes and instincts, allows an organism to adapt to its environment. But unlike instincts and reflexes, learned behaviors involve change and experience: learning is a relatively permanent change in behavior or knowledge that results from experience.
